Dr Hauschka (Bain Amande) Almond Soothing Bath Essence (10ml) 0.34 fl ozLustHaveIt : September 2014
Dr Hauschka is a German brand and I know you you buy it at the Dr Hauschka counter at Smith & Caughey in Auckland (it's the only place I've seen it) they have a NZ web shop too. I'm a newbie to Dr H. I'm going to be soaking myself in this almond scented goodness tonight (my new flat has a bath).  My only negative is I wish we'd received a bigger size but I guess if you bought a bigger bottle of this and if it's decantable then you can fill up this vial to take traveling and that's a bonus. The full size is 100ml and costs NZ$44.00 here. I like that Dr Hauschka is a cruelty free brand.
Glam by Manicare Express 3 in Popping Pink (22177) 5mlLustHaveIt : September 2014I'm a magpie for pink and sparkles/glitter/shimmer so this is right up my street. It contain's a pink nail polish some pink gem's and a nail stencil so you can put the gem's into the stencil to create a design. I guess you add the gem's to wet nail's to set them as there's no glue in the box but the top of this product has a fine tip. The Cosmetic Kitchen Macadamia Wax Creme Highlighter (6g) AU$24.90LustHaveIt : September 2014This is an Australian brand so we've got quite a good mix of Countries represented in this month's bag. I've never heard of a creme highlighter but I do like macadamia scented product's and I like the different shaped packaging of this product. It comes with an applicator under the lid. I didn't receive a product card in my bag so I had to go to The Cosmetics Kitchen's site for information on this product. It's a skin highlighter that contain's some shimmer but once you put it on your skin it leaves a nice glow (no glitter visible). I definitely will give this product a go and report back.
